Credit Card Changes

Monday, August 24th, 2009

Despite the credit card companies reducing credit limits, and changing due dates on payments to shorten up float time; credit card issuers are trying to pass proposed changes to consumers such as:

Increased interest rates
Increased fees
Increased minimum payments
Fees to use award miles/points

Along with these factors, credit issuers are now favoring customers who have banking relationships with them in making decisions on credit card rates and limits in order to protect themselves against default which is now at an all time high.

The more accounts you have with one bank, the better your chances are getting a credit card through that institution. Now more then ever, make sure you pay the minimum on your credit card or risk not having one!

Attention Real Estate Investors!

Friday, August 21st, 2009

How can you avoid the “fee traps” of title insurance? Start by finding the right title insurance company!

Title insurance can be one of the most expensive costs of closing on a piece of real estate. The major title companies; Fidelity National, First American, Stewart Title, and Old Republic all reported losses in 2008. They like every other service provider of real estate are looking for ways to increase costs. Many of these companies are charging consumers separate fees for title research on top of the premiums for insurance.

Early in the process of purchasing or refinancing a mortgage, let the lender know you want to select the title insurer, then you can shop around for the best deal. Do this by researching title insurance companies online and check whether there are more fees on top of the premium. Take the time to do the research and save yourself real dollars!

Consumer Credit Card Rights – Do You Know Your Rights?

Thursday, August 20th, 2009

Today, part of the new credit card changes go into effect. How does this effect you?

1. What credit card issuers are required to do:

* Give at least 45 days notice in most cases before changing rates or fees
* Not count your payment as late unless they mailed your bills at least 21 days before the due date

2. What issuers are not required to do:

* Warn you about credit line reductions or account closings
* Warn you of a rate increase if your payment is 60 or more days late.

Think "Outside of the Box" Financing

Monday, August 17th, 2009

With the tightening of the credit markets, do you find it is near impossible to get conventional financing for your business? Where can you go in this day and age if you need an infusion of capital?

Here are 5 popular ways business owners raise cash.

1. Angel investors and venture capital. If your business plan makes sense to these private money lenders, they will invest in an industry they feel confident in know and understand.

2. Private loans. Key management and other private investors, including individual retirement plans who have capital that is not earning much may be interested in short term lending.

3. Equipment Leasing. If you need the capital to buy equipment, consider leasing over purchasing.

4. Factoring. Selling your receivables to a third party generally at a discount, is known as factoring. There are pros and cons to using factors so make sure you understand the rules before you sell your receivables for cash.

5. Asset-based lending. Financing secured with collateral such as equipment, real estate and inventory or other assets.

Be creative, think outside of the box and remember, do your homework!

How You Can Save Thousands on Closing Costs

Wednesday, August 12th, 2009

What are closing costs? They are the fees and expenses associated with the transfer of property from one owner to another. Both buyers and sellers pay these fees on top of the purchase price for the property.

They include:

· Loan origination fees
· Title research
· Appraisals
· Recording fees
· Notary fees
· Processing fees
· Attorney fees (if an attorney was involved)

These fees and the other can add up to thousands of dollars. However, there are ways you can save money on these and other fees associated with the transfer of property or if you are re-financing your own home.

1. Get educated. Talk to realtors, mortgage brokers, bankers and title companies to get an estimate of the fees involved.

2. Shop around for the best deal.

3. Go online to HUD and download their information on mortgage closing costs.

4. Do business with people you know and trust. Ask for referrals from friends and family.

Finally, ask if any fees can be negotiated. Obtaining loans in this market is difficult and your realtor or title company may be willing to cut their fees to guarantee your business!
